當前位置:聚美館>智慧生活>心理>

fme新手入門教程

心理 閱讀(1.98W)
fme新手入門教程

FME讀取數據

透過讀模組或者是轉換器完成數據的讀取,這個有基礎的朋友都知道。但FME在讀入數據後是怎麼在程序裏進行處理的在初學FME的時候,偶然有一次讀取文字數據的時候,我才真正體會到,什麼叫讓數據自由的流動。只要是FME支援的格式,在讀取到FME之後都是作爲一個要素在FME中進行流動的,針對文字數據,就是一行文字,針對數據庫中,就是一條記錄,針對shp,就是一個點/線/面。

處理數據

在FME中,如果只做格式間的轉換,那是不需要處理的,那也不能叫數據處理,只能叫格式轉換。在FME中,絕大多數數據處理都是使用轉換器來完成的,轉換器也是FME中最重要的一部分內容。在FME中,數據可以自由的在模板中流動,一個轉換器處理後的數據,可以直接傳遞給下一個轉換器。一個寫好的FME模板,就像一條流水線一樣,每個模組各司其職,完成從數據輸入到處理最後輸出,就像一個數據處理工廠一樣。

寫出數據

我們處理完的數據,最後要寫出去纔算完成了一個完整的數據轉換流程。FME支援的寫出格式,就像支援的讀入格式一樣多。而數據寫出,從我使用FME的經驗來看,需要學習的無外乎幾點:

1、使用模板

在FME中,使用模板可以寫出很漂亮的Excel數據也可以寫出帶別名、帶值域的mdb/gdb數據。

2、數據類型定義

由於工作原因,我接觸的數據大多都是空間數據,針對空間數據,基本上在寫出的時候,都需要定義其幾何類型,也就是點/線/面/註記/多面體……等一系列的類型。

3、幾種模式

在寫出的時候,FME對數據庫類型的數據,可以實現增刪改操作。

others

使用FME做數據的處理,需要學習多方面的內容,我將推出FME系列教程,從基礎知識開始,與大家一步步學習FME,中間也會穿插一些其他的數據處理方面的知識。如果你有好的問題,也歡迎與我聯繫,我將在課程中做出解答。